TOUGH QUALIFYING FOR TAKA IN SEPANG

LCR Honda IDEMITSU rider Takaaki Nakagami suffered disappointment in qualifying as thunderstorms hit the Malaysia Grand Prix. Heavy rain deluged the Sepang International Circuit during the latter stages of Saturday with Nakagami eventually having to settle for 22nd position on the timesheets.

As on Friday, Taka was on the pace during a dry FP3 and, despite finishing in 14th, was only a couple of tenths outside the top 10 positions. Like many riders, he then fell in FP4 as the rain came down in earnest and, after a delay, both qualifying sessions took place on a soaked circuit. Despite starting from the eighth row of the grid, the LCR man remains confident he can battle through the field on Sunday, provided the race remains dry.

#30 Takaaki Nakagami – (22nd – 2’16.558) 

“Of course I’m disappointed with today’s result in qualifying. It was a difficult situation as there were some delays and the track condition went from dry to full wet and it was not perfect. I think we didn’t quite get the front tyre choice right, we went with soft and it was too soft for me – the feeling with the front of the bike was not so nice. We were losing a lot of time on the braking point. Everyone knows that the schedule has changed a little bit tomorrow, so hopefully the race will be in dry conditions because we have good pace in the dry and a good set-up on the bike. I believe we can catch up to a good position.”
